About Maverick Bio

 

Maverick Bio is an Australian biotechnology company producing high-quality medical biomaterials used in healthcare around the world. Our Supply Chain team plays an important role in ensuring our manufacturing operations receive the right materials at the right time while maintaining the highest standards of quality, traceability and safety.

 

What you’ll be doing

 

  • Receive and inspect incoming deliveries
  • Store materials accurately and safely
  • Pick, pack and dispatch customer orders
  • Process inventory transactions using Business Central
  • Maintain accurate stock records and product traceability
  • Assist with stocktakes and inventory control
  • Handle refrigerated and frozen inventory
  • Maintain a clean, organised and safe warehouse
  • Support manufacturing and logistics as required
